查看: 868|回复: 0

​【LED显示屏基础编程】序列之4:LED显示屏边框滚动

[复制链接]
  • TA的每日心情
    开心
    2019-6-24 16:41
  • 签到天数: 709 天

    连续签到: 1 天

    [LV.9]以坛为家II

    发表于 2016-2-18 10:41:56 | 显示全部楼层 |阅读模式
    分享到:
    【LED显示屏基础编程】序列之4:LED显示屏边框滚动

          本节我们主要是从下面4个方面进行讲解:
    1.准备工作
    2.硬件部分
    3.软件部分
    4.效果展示
    一、准备工作
    1.电脑一台;
    2.Mini-USB数据线一根;
    3.LED显示屏一块;
    4.LED显示屏控制板一块;
    5.STC_ISP下载软件。
    二、硬件部分
    1.安装驱动,只有驱动了才可以进行下面的工作。如下图所示:


    2.Mini-USB接口部分电路。如下图所示:

    3.LED显示屏输出端口部分电路。如下图所示:

    4.电源部分电路。如下图所示:

    三、软件部分
    1.新建文件夹,如下图所示:

    2.在文件夹里面再新建几个自己想要的子文件夹,方便放工程文件。如下图所示:

    3.打开keil新建工程,如下图所示:

    4.选择硬件对应的CPU,如下图所示:

    5.创建工程组,如下图所示:


    6.为了工程的清洁,把生成文件放到Outproj里面,如下图所示:

    7.下面就是编程了,新建main文件和外围接口。如下所示:

    8.现在就是把源文件加到工程里面即可。如下图所示:

    9.下面是主函数的代码编写了。如下图所示:




    注意:可以设置边框滚动的速度,可以快也可以慢,根据具体的来情况来设置。


    四、效果展示
    1.打开STC_ISP下载软件。如下图所示:

    2.配置好STC_ISP相关的内容,配置芯片型号和串口号,并选择已经编译好的hex文件,然后点击download即可完成烧录工作。如下图所示:


    3.此时屏幕边框就会滚动起来。如下图所示:




    这节我们就到此吧,是不是很好玩啊!
    回复

    使用道具 举报

    您需要登录后才可以回帖 注册/登录

    本版积分规则

    手机版|小黑屋|与非网

    GMT+8, 2024-4-23 18:04 , Processed in 0.106056 second(s), 17 queries , MemCache On.

    ICP经营许可证 苏B2-20140176  苏ICP备14012660号-2   苏州灵动帧格网络科技有限公司 版权所有.

    苏公网安备 32059002001037号

    Powered by Discuz! X3.4

    Copyright © 2001-2024, Tencent Cloud.